What is a jewelry assistant?

Jewelry Assistants are professionals who support jewelers and sales teams in jewelry stores or workshops. Their duties often include organizing inventory, handling customer inquiries, assisting with sales, cleaning and displaying jewelry, and sometimes helping with minor repairs or administrative tasks. They play a crucial role in maintaining the smooth operation of jewelry businesses and ensuring customers have a positive experience. Jewelry Assistants need good communication skills, attention to detail, and sometimes knowledge of gemstones and precious metals.

What are some common challenges faced by jewelry assistants when managing inventory and orders?

Jewelry Assistants often face the challenge of maintaining accurate inventory records due to the small size and high value of items. Keeping track of incoming shipments, outgoing sales, and restocking needs requires strong organizational skills and attention to detail. Additionally, Jewelry Assistants must coordinate with sales staff, suppliers, and sometimes customers to ensure timely order fulfillment and resolve discrepancies. It's important to develop efficient tracking systems and clear communication practices to succeed in this aspect of the role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a jewelry assistant?

To thrive as a Jewelry Assistant, you need attention to detail, basic knowledge of gemstones and metals, and experience in retail or customer service, often supported by a high school diploma. Familiarity with point-of-sale (POS) systems, jewelry cleaning tools, and inventory management software is typically required. Strong interpersonal skills, organization, and the ability to handle delicate items with care make someone stand out in this position. These skills ensure accurate transactions, excellent customer experiences, and proper handling of valuable merchandise.

Job description

Position Summary:

Assist the store manager with daily tasks. Act as the supervisor for the location in the absence of the store manager. Maximize financial performance of the store. Assist the store manager to achieve growth and sales targets by successfully managing and motivating sales team. Create an emotional connection between Fred Meyer Jewelers and our customers through engagement and communication, during every shopping occasion in store and online. Achieve personal sales targets. Demonstrate the companys core values of respect, honesty, integrity, diversity, inclusion and safety of self and others.

    Desired Previous Job Experience:
    • Knowledge of Fred Meyer Jewelers policies, procedures
    • Management experience
    • Proficiency with Microsoft Outlook, First Place, Act , Intranet
    • Experience directing/participating on project teams
    Minimum Position Qualifications/Education:
    • High school diploma or general education degree (GED) plus a minimum of 6 months Fred Meyer experience and 1 year jewelry sales experience; or combination of relevant education and experience
    • Minimum 18 years of age
    • Ability to pass drug test
    • Maintain confidentiality
    • Accuracy/attention to detail
    • Ability to organize/prioritize tasks/projects
    • Diamond Council of America (DCA) courses completed within a year from being hired to this position
    Essential Job Functions:
    • Model Customer 1st behavior; deliver and encourage other associates to deliver excellent customer service
    • Maintain profitability of location through sales and proper shrink and expense control
    • Achieve personal sales targets by turning every customers lifes meaningful moments into a celebration by offering a fine jewelry experience that is approachable, special and lasting
    • Support store manager in training and development of sales professionals; follow-up on initial onboarding training of new team members
    • Achieve personal targets that drive sales (e.g., credit applications, protection plan and Diamond Design Parties)
    • Foster life-long emotional connections with customers by clienteling
    • Support the coordination of the operations functions
    • Display merchandise and promotional materials in accordance with corporate merchandising plans
    • Advise customers on quality, cuts, and/or value of jewelry and gems and assist in selecting mountings and/or settings for gems
    • Provide product knowledge, features and benefits to customers when presenting merchandise
    • Estimate repairs and inspect/clean customer jewelry
    • Perform watch battery replacements and band adjustments
    • Suggest designs for custom jewelry
    • Follow receiving and processing procedures
    • Maintain overstock/understock conditions to retain ordering system integrity
    • Maintain daily/weekly sales and take appropriate action
    • Respond to customer comments/complaints
    • Complete customer incident and associate incident/accident report forms
    • Participate in inventory process
    • Complete case counts
    • Assist with and process time and attendance
    • Develop staff scheduling and enter weekly work schedule for associates
    • Assist with special maintenance arrangements for location
    • Maintain flexibility to work any shift, including holidays and overtime
    • Travel to other store locations to provide back-up coverage on an occasional basis
    • Must be able to perform the essential functions of this position with or without reasonable accommodation
